What specific attribute or ingredient makes a hydrating hair conditioner truly effective, and how should I read labels?

The hydration power comes from the ingredient mix and how the formula delivers moisture. Look for humectants like glycerin or propanediol that attract moisture, emollients such as Mafura oil, shea butter, or plant oils that soften hair, and occlusives that seal in moisture. Brand blends in the list show how this works: SheaMoisture's Manuka Honey & Mafura Oil Intensive Hydration Conditioner combines honey and Mafura oil for deep moisture, while a sulfate-free option from Cantu focuses on gentle, lasting hydration without sulfates. Read labels for sulfate presence if you color-treat your hair, and check for fragrances or essential oils if you have sensitivities.

What maintenance or compatibility tips should I follow when using a hydrating hair conditioner?

Store the product in a cool, dry place and keep the cap tightly closed to preserve moisture. Patch-test new formulas to avoid irritation, especially if you have sensitive skin or allergies. If you color-treat or chemically treat your hair, choose sulfate-free options like Cantu Shea Butter Sulfate-Free Hydrating Cream Conditioner for gentler conditioning. Use the conditioner as directed and rinse thoroughly to prevent buildup, adapting usage to your hair’s response and environmental conditions.
